As nouns, muddiness is a hypernym of obfuscation; that is, muddiness is a word with a broader meaning than obfuscation:
  • obfuscation: confusion resulting from failure to understand
  • muddiness: a mental state characterized by a lack of clear and orderly thought and behavior
Other hypernyms of obfuscation include confusedness, confusion, disarray, mental confusion.
